The most common side effects of XALKORI in adults with NSCLC include:
- •
- vision problems
- •
- nausea, diarrhea, or vomiting
- •
- swelling of your hands, feet, face, or eyes
- •
- constipation
- •
- increased liver function blood tests
| - •
- tiredness
- •
- decreased appetite
- •
- upper respiratory infection
- •
- dizziness
- •
- feeling of numbness or tingling in your arms or legs

The most common side effects of XALKORI in people with ALCL include: |
- •
- diarrhea, vomiting, or nausea
- •
- vision problems
- •
- headache
- •
- muscle and joint pain
- •
- mouth sores
- •
- tiredness
| - •
- decreased appetite
- •
- fever
- •
- stomach-area (abdominal) pain
- •
- cough
- •
- itchy skin
- •
- low blood counts

The most common side effects of XALKORI in adults with IMT include: |
- •
- vision problems
- •
- nausea
- •
- swelling of your hands, feet, face, or eyes

The most common side effects of XALKORI in children with IMT include: |
- •
- vomiting, nausea, or diarrhea
- •
- stomach-area (abdominal) pain
- •
- rash
- •
- vision problems
- •
- upper respiratory infection
- •
- cough
| - •
- fever
- •
- muscle and joint pain
- •
- tiredness
- •
- swelling of your hands, feet, face, or eyes
- •
- constipation
- •
- headache
|
XALKORI may cause fertility problems in females and males, which may affect the ability to have children. Talk to your healthcare provider if you have concerns about fertility.
